Tripomatic features and specs

  • Detailed Offline Maps
    Sygic Travel Maps offers high-quality offline maps, allowing users to navigate and explore destinations without relying on an internet connection. This is particularly useful for travelers in areas with poor connectivity.
  • Comprehensive Travel Guide
    The platform provides extensive travel information, including top attractions, restaurants, and activities, making it easier for users to plan their trips efficiently.
  • Custom Itinerary Planning
    Users can create personalized itineraries, adding places of interest and organizing their trips in a systematic manner. This feature helps in making the most of the travel experience.
  • User Reviews and Ratings
    Sygic Travel Maps includes user reviews and ratings for various points of interest, offering valuable insights and helping travelers make informed decisions.
  • Multi-Platform Accessibility
    The service is available on multiple platforms, including web, iOS, and Android, ensuring users can access their travel plans and maps seamlessly across different devices.

Possible disadvantages of Tripomatic

  • Premium Features Require Payment
    Many of the advanced features, such as offline maps and detailed travel guides, require a subscription or in-app purchases, which may not be ideal for budget-conscious travelers.
  • Interface Learning Curve
    Some users may find the interface a bit complex initially, requiring a learning curve to fully utilize all the features and functionalities.
  • Occasional Performance Issues
    Users have occasionally reported performance issues such as app crashes or slow loading times, which can be inconvenient when trying to access information quickly.
  • Limited Free Version
    The free version of Sygic Travel Maps offers limited functionalities, which may not be sufficient for comprehensive travel planning and navigation.
  • Data Accuracy
    While generally reliable, there have been instances where the information provided, such as opening hours or service availability, is outdated or inaccurate.

The Top 20 Online Trip Itinerary Planning Websites
Tripomatic is a great travel-planning app that uses a map to explore locations. They use their own database of tourist attractions, which means that there is a limit to the number of cities (about 1500) and sights you can add to your trip. They have a mobile app, and you can upgrade to premium to view your trip on an offline map.

  • I spent 2000 hours building a tool that makes your Google Maps routes even faster (and more efficient) as you travel through Europe
    I've been using Sygic Travel from the Czech Republic and really like it. It doesn't use Google Maps, but you just press the location on the map, click add, then it autosorts to give you an optimized itinerary (like yours does) and spits out the itinerary. I think your biggest issue is being cost competitive. I paid $7.99 once for Sygic Premium (I think it's $9.99 now), so $19.99/month is an entire tier higher in... Source: about 4 years ago
